Lee Raven Boy Thief

Role: Director & adapted for stage.
Performers: 16 performers aged 11-15
A world theatre premiere - an adapted version of Zizou Corder's story including devised physical theatre sections & traditional storytelling techniques created with the cast. 
This tale explores poverty, child abuse, greed & exploitation & the power of storytelling to save & destroy us.   Set in 2046, in an England partly underwater, Lee Raven, has stolen something he really didn't mean to. Now he faces a perilous flight through London as he tries to escape.
Performed at Pegasus Theatre
Designer: Nomi Everall
